ASTM Standard

 

 

American standard H-beams are classified into three main quality grades: A36, A572, and A992.
A36 and A572 represent carbon structural steels, while A992 is a low-alloy steel.

 

European Standard Section Steel
 

The UB series (Universal Beams) of British standard H-section steel is used in various steel structural buildings, marine engineering, and energy projects. It is available in European standard angle steel, channel steel, and H-beams. These are also used in the structural construction of offshore oil platforms, LNG facilities, refineries, and other modular steel structures.


1. Specification Implementation Standard
BS EN 10365-2017 replaces the old standard EN 10034-1993.


2. Material Implementation Standard
Materials: S235JR/J0/J2, S275JR/J0/J2, S355JR/J0/J2/K2, S450J0

Characteristic Features of H-Beams
 

Flange Width and Depth

The flanges in an H-beam are generally wider than the web, and the beam tends to have a square appearance due to the similar depth of the web and flanges.

Load-Bearing

They are designed to carry heavy loads, making them ideal for building structures where weight distribution over a wide area is critical.

Web Thickness

The thickness of the web in an H-beam is usually greater than that of an I-beam, which offers higher resistance to bending.

Common Standard Sizes of H-Beams

H-beams come in various sizes to meet different structural demands. Dimensions are typically specified by height (distance between flange edges), flange width, web thickness, and flange thickness. Common sizes include:


100×100 mm: Suitable for smaller structures or confined spaces.


150×150 mm: A versatile size for residential and light industrial applications.


200×200 mm: Common in larger buildings and industrial projects.


300×300 mm: Ideal for heavy-duty applications like bridges and large industrial structures.
